Abstract

A Moore--Read interface carries a chiral Majorana mode on a boundary whose geometry may itself fluctuate. Fixed-edge theory does not determine how this neutral mode should be transported when the interface bends and moves, or how its dynamics couples to the fluctuating shape. Here we construct a spatially reparametrization-invariant Majorana theory on the nonrelativistic worldsheet of a freely moving interface. The changing line element fixes a universal half-density transport law, while additional curvature- and velocity-dependent couplings remain controlled by microscopic interface physics. The resulting framework identifies the Majorana stress tensor as the mediator between neutral and geometric dynamics and provides the neutral sector needed for effective theories of dynamical non-Abelian quantum Hall interfaces.
